A medical alert system in Manor can provide lots of senior and disabled people with the ability to reside on their own, and have a high degree of freedom. Here’s what you need to know before signing up with a medical alert system service provider.

Typically, an alert system is usually comprised of a wrist band transmitter– resembling a wrist watch– or a necklace-type transmitter that is used at all times. If the individual should have a medical problem or accident, they can just press a button on the transmitter to communicate with the medical alert monitoring center.

This assists the monitoring center professional to better advise you in case of a medical emergency, and they may also send out emergency medical help, if needed. Optionally, the tracking center can be advised to likewise call one or more of your family members whenever the help button is pressed. The rate of a medical alert system can differ according to the level of service you require; however, basically they are a very reasonably-priced option to assisted living.

Medical Alert Systems with Fall Detection

The very best medical alert systems have actually come a long way in the last 5 years. Today’s innovative systems can spot when a user has fallen immediately. It’s all in the advanced algorithms developed by inventive engineers that are embedded into small instruments that are saving lives everyday. These smart-systems can identify (most of the time) whether someone has in fact fallen, or if somebody has to taken a seat suddenly.

Senior Alert Systems and Medical Alert Devices FAQ

    1. Do You want a Home-Based or Mobile System?

Initially, medical alert systems were developed to work inside your home, with your landline telephone.

And you can still go that route. Numerous companies now also offer the choice of home-based systems that work over a cellular network, for those who might not have a landline.

With these systems, pushing the wearable call button allows you to talk to a dispatcher through a base system situated in your home.

Lots of companies offer mobile options, too. You can utilize these systems in your home, however they’ll also permit you to call for help while you’re out and about.

These operate over cellular networks and include GPS technology. This way, if you get lost or press the call button for aid, however are unable to talk, the tracking service can locate you.

  • Should You Include a Fall-Detection Feature?

Some businesses provide the choice of automated fall detection, for an extra month-to-month cost. Makers say these gadgets notice falls when they occur and immediately call the dispatch center, simply as they would if you had pressed the call button.

  • Whats the Cost?

Look for a company with no additional costs related to equipment, shipping, setup, activation, or service and repair. Do not fall for rip-offs that use free service or “donated or used” devices.
Agreements. You need to not need to participate in a long-term agreement. You ought to only need to pay ongoing month-to-month fees, which ought to vary in between $25 and $45 a month (about $1 a day). Beware about spending for service beforehand, since you never ever understand when you’ll have to stop the service briefly (due to a hospitalization, for instance) or completely.
Warranty and cancellation policies. Search for a complete money-back guarantee, or a minimum of a trial duration, in case you are not pleased with the service. And you’ll desire the capability to cancel at any time with no penalties (and a full refund if month-to-month fees have actually already been paid).
Discounts. Inquire about discount rates for numerous people in the exact same home, along with for veterans, subscription organizations, medical insurance coverage or via a health center, medical or care company. Ask if the company uses any discount choices or a moving fee scale for people with lower earnings.
For the a lot of part, Medicare and personal insurance companies will not cover the expenses of a medical alert. You can examine with your personal insurance coverage business to see if it provides discounts or referrals.
Tax reductions. Check with your tax professional to discover if the expense of a medical alert is tax deductible as a medically required cost.

A medical alarm can produce a big distinction in the lives of elderly individuals and individuals with special needs. Likewise called a medical alert or Personal Emergency Response System (PERS), it was developed to signify the presence of a danger needing instant awareness and summon emergency medical employees. Seniors or disabled people living by themselves are the primary users of this kind of gadget.

Home accidents are common, but there are instances where they can be fatal. These are mostly cases where victims may have made it if aid had appeared sooner. Elders or individuals with disabilities have a higher danger for these things, and might be not able to manage them without having help. This is when a medical alarm might be indispensable.

The requirement of aid that wearers of medical alert system have entitlement to is another major selling point. Individuals who respond to calls at the tracking center are trained to manage medical emergencies and will supply immediate assistance. Users’ private information is generally kept on file to ensure that good care and precautions are taken when reacting to medical problems or emergencies.

    Manor (/ˈmeɪnər/ MAY-nər) is a city in Travis County, Texas, United States. Manor is located 12 miles northeast of Austin and is part of the Austin-Round Rock metropolitan area. The population was 13,652 at the 2020 census. Manor is one of the faster-growing suburbs of Austin.[5] The city was the seventh fastest growing suburb in America in 2018 by Realtor.com and the 17th best small suburb to live in by U.S. News and World Report in 2019.[6][7]

    Manor is located along U.S. Highway 290[8] at 30°20′35″N 97°33′24″W / 30.343071°N 97.556710°W / 30.343071; -97.556710 (30.343071, –97.556710),[9] 12 miles (19 km) east of downtown Austin.[10] According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 7.35 square miles (18.48 km2), all land.
